Despite what you might and will no doubt continue to see from dodgy sites and
dealers every week, Viaccess2 is not hacked. It is not near to be hacked - in
fact, cards cannot even be opened. Old backdoors are useless. Work, of course,
has and will continue to try to find a solution . . . but you should know now
that it could be years before one comes. We all know encryption systems for
which this is true. So what is to be done?
Many of you will have followed efforts started at Vkeys to test the water for a
brute-force attempt. What this will involve is searching for a SINGLE key in a
keyspace 2^64 big . . . in short, it is something which has never been
attempted before in the satellite community. As such, all who join the effort
will be part of history the second they do so.

In short, after obtaining an ID here, you will be able to download keyfinder
software specially written for this effort. Once you instal the software on
your PC/PCs, you will be given an area/areas of keyspace to search for each PC
you have every time you visit. You could order, say, ten areas at a time for
each PC and not have to return again for 2 or 3 weeks.
Each time you return previous area/areas you searched will be checked by the
server. You drop off an area/s, you pick up an area/s. This is all done pretty
much automatically. Once your area is loaded in your PC, you can let keyfinder
run in the background and forget about it until you need to return to pick up a
new area/s. You do NOT have to be online any other time than when you pick
up/drop off your areas. But you should allow your PC and keyfinder to run 24/7
offline or online. This is VERY important. And when you are not using your PC
for anything else - ie, when you are at work or overnight, keyfinder will
naturally run fastest.
